Popular shoot 'em up developer Cave announced today that its first virtual reality game is in development, and it's something... quite different. The title is A.I Am Monster, and it'll be released in 2017.

While it retains the theme of destruction, it puts the players in the extremely large shoes of what appears to be a giant robot schoolgirl, wreaking havoc in Tokyo, and having to fend off the attacks of the Japanese Self-Defense Force. Basically, you're a cuter Godzilla.

You can crush skyscrapers by bitchslapping them, pick up tanks and throw them on the rest of the platoon, and even shoot massively destructive energy beams.

No platforms have been officially announced as of yet, but the first trailer shows the game tested on an HTC Vive, yet, it might come for other headsets as well. For the moment there is no precise information.

As you can see in the first trailer below, the goal of the game is to achieve the highest destruction score, which is measured in the form of monetary damaged inflicted to the city and its defenders.
